Kimya Dawson – Remember That I Love You

Oh so cute and oh so depressing.

How can music that sounds so delightful be about such horrible subjects. “My Mom” is about Dawson’s mother on her death bed, but as might be written by a small child, but sung in a rather happy way, as a nursery rhyme might be sung. This creates a really weird contrast of light and dark which really pushes the content of the lyrics in a way that is really sad.

“…and if you want to kill yourself, remember that I love you.”
alongside
“they think we’re disposable, well both my thumbs opposable are spelled out on a double word and triple letter score”.

The whole album has this thematic contrast. All of the songs are very simple and use a limited number of instruments, with simple rhyming patters and it is a very easy listen, but it succeeds in making you think, if you listen to the lyrics. This album will make you laugh, smile, frown and cry.
I’ve just seen that she is playing the UK in May and I’ll be definitely buying a ticket.

Listen to this album: While it’s raining outside.
